Frequently Asked Questions about Addison Orange

How much are Studio apartments in Addison Orange?

There are currently 91 Studio Apartments in Addison Orange with rent ranges from $1,450 to $7,723 with an average price of $2,557.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Addison Orange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Addison Orange ranges from $800 to $12,010 with an average monthly rent of $2,896.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Addison Orange c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Addison Orange range from $2,000 to $14,286.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,466.

How expensive are Addison Orange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 233 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Addison Orange on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$6,346 - averaging $3,354 for the location.
